After The Secret Lives of Mormon Wives season 4 showed Taylor Frankie Paul and ex Dakota Mortensen together hours before she left for The Bachelorette, the question on everyone’s mind is: how open was she with the contestants about how recent that relationship had been?
“I feel like I was very open with them, especially those that asked, because I really told everyone as a whole if there’s anything you want to know, please let me know, because I wasn’t trying to shove everything down their throat of that in my life,” Taylor, 31, exclusively told Us Weekly at a New York City press dinner on Tuesday, March 17. “I wanted to tell them what they wanted to know.”
Taylor recalled being “very adamant” with the men on The Bachelorette that she would be willing to discuss her past with them.
“Like, ‘Please ask anything. I am [a] very open book,’” she recalled. “Especially the ones towards the end, I was open with the situation. So yeah, I was very honest, I feel like.”

Days before season 22 of The Bachelorette airs on Sunday, March 22, multiple outlets reported that Taylor and Dakota were involved in an incident the previous month — which led to season 5 of Mormon Wives to halt production. (Taylor and Dakota are parents to son Ever, 23 months. She also shares daughter Indy and son Ocean with ex-husband Tate Paul.)
At the time, spokesperson for the Draper City Police Department in Utah confirmed to Us that there was an open “domestic assault investigation” concerning Taylor and Dakota and allegations were “made in both directions.”
Taylor, for her part, addressed the alleged dispute in her interview with Us and claimed that there’s “more to the context to everything.”
“It’s been hard. And it sucks to be in this position,” she said. “And the mother that I am, that is something I will always stand my ground on. I believe that I am a good mother and I have always treated my kids very well. So the headlines that are out right now are very hard to see because that’s not the truth of it. I have always treated my children with respect and I’ve never touched them. So it’s been really hard.”

Taylor noted that The Bachelorette premiere and Tuesday’s event was “unfortunate” timing amid the ongoing allegations.
“It’s another premiere that’s been taken away from me,” she said. “I’ve never enjoyed a premiere for any one of my shows. So it’s just been very sad.”
As for Taylor’s future with Mormon Wives, she admitted to Good Morning America on Wednesday, March 18, that it’s “hard to see” past what’s happening in her life right now.
“When your life is broadcasted out there in these headlines, it’s like the end of the world. That’s what it feels like, I’m not going to lie,” she said. “But I will say, I’ve been here before and I got through it and shared my story … so I’m hoping that I can do that again.”
